The state of California Department Of Parks & Recreation has recorded this lot as a prehistoric sight. There is a single basalt bedrock mortar feature consisting of 13 milling surfaces. Given the number of milling surfaces and surrounding vegetation, it seems that this feature involved multiple individuals performing seasonal acorn & seed processing by the Maidu Indian tribe.
